Disconnecting the Bluetooth Photo Print Adapter

Make sure PictureMate Pal is not printing, then pull the adapter out of its port.
Caution: Do not remove the adapter while it is communicating with a device or
while PictureMate Pal is printing; this may cause PictureMate Pal to malfunction.
